Concord West is a high growth suburb in Canada Bay, NSW 2138, about 11km from Sydney CBD. Its median house price of $2.88M is more expensive than the NSW average. The suburb has 4 schools, a transport score of 95/100, and is about 14km inland. Concord West has an overall score of 92/100, based on transport, liveability and education, plus a separate residential safety score of 97/100.

Frequently asked questions about Concord West
Is Concord West safe?
Concord West has a residential safety score of 97/100, based on residential crime (break-ins, theft from dwellings, vehicle theft, domestic assault and robbery) per resident relative to the NSW median. Its total recorded incident rate is 2,995 per 100,000 across all categories.
What are property prices in Concord West?
In Concord West, the median house price is $2.88M and the median unit price is $1.87M. Median weekly house rent is $890.
How far is Concord West from Sydney CBD?
Concord West is about 11.2 km from Sydney CBD, an estimated 30 minutes by public transport.
What schools are in Concord West?
Concord West has 4 schools, with an average ICSEA of 1093 (the national average is 1000). Schools are listed factually, not ranked.
What is public transport like in Concord West?
Concord West has a transport score of 95/100, including 1 train station and 25 bus stops.
